
L.I.T.
Leaders in Training is a mentorship program, provided in an inclusive educational environment, supporting active, compassionate lifelong learners with a global understanding, and community leadership. Students are supported, encouraged, and challenged to maximize academic and social achievements, inquiry, independence and individualized goal achievement. I.B., (International Baccalaureate). Inclusion is the acceptance, understanding and catering for students’ individual differences and diversity. It is an ongoing process that includes consistent daily collaboration with educators and students, providing access to the same routines and curriculum, encouraging participation that aims to increase access, engagement in learning and holding all students up to the highest of standards regardless of a disability.

Pedagogy/Methodology
Constructivist, Collaborative, Integrative, Reflective and Inquiry Based Learning
Constructivist provides students with greater autonomy in defining and directing their own learning.
Collaboration helps to ensure children withlearning disabilities get a free appropriate public education, including specialized instruction, in a regular classroom.
Integration provides a setting where students with disabilities learn alongside peers without disabilities. Based on individualized need, ancillary services, push-in and pull-out supports are implemented.
Reflective learning allows learners to develop critical thinking skills and, improve on future performance by analysing what they have learned and how far they have come.
Inquiry-based learning is a research-based learning technique used to promote student comprehension, self-reflection, and research skills.
